ST PETER'S URBAN VILLAGE TRUST

Charity overview
Activities - how the charity spends its money
Provides accommodation and open space on site for education, accommodation and sport for children, charities, the disabled and general public.

Governing document
It is not the full text of the charity's governing document.
MEMORANDUM AND ARTICLES OF ASSOCIATION INCORPORATED 7 AUGUST 1984 AS AMENDED BY SPECIAL RESOLUTION OF 10 DECEMBER 1984
Charitable objects
THE COMPANY IS ESTABLISHED FOR THE FOLLOWING PURPOSES:- (1) TO ADVANCE EDUCATION BY PROVIDING ON THE SITE OF ST PETERS COLLEGE, SALTLEY, BIRMINGHAM FACILITIES FOR EDUCATION INCLUDING (WITHOUT PREJUDICE TO THE GENERALITY OF THE FOREGOING):- A) LECTURES, CLASSES, SEMINARS AND MEETINGS ON SUBJECTS OF ACADEMIC CULTURAL AND VOCATIONAL INTEREST : B) ADVICE UPON E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ITIES (2) TO PROVIDE ON THE SAID SITE RESIDENTIAL ACCOMMODATION (SPECIALLY ADOPTED WHERE NECESSARY) AT MODERATE COST FOR THE IMMEDIATE FAMILIES OF PERSONS WHO BY REASON OF AGE DISABLEMENT OR SICKNESS OR INFIRMITY ARE IN NEED OF IT.
